Steve Hannagan made the Indy 500 a household word, and he converted Miami Beach from a mosquito-infested swamp into a place where bathing beauties converted during winter. He also made Coca Cola the drink of choice.

In 1936 Hannagan became the man who advised Averell Harriman and Union Pacific Railroad of all the steps necessary to make Sun Valley a winter wonderland destination that people from all over the country would flock to.

Learn about some of the advertising techniques Hannagan used, including his famous ad featuring a shirtless skier sweating under the Sun Valley sun, when local historian John W. Lundin presents “Steve Hannagan: Prince of Press Agents” at Ketchum’s Community Library.
